Hailing from the Infernac Universe, the Armorizers are a group of living rocks. Known Armorizers include Bouldercrash, Magneous, Shard and Nucleous.
Toys
- Infernac Universe Bouldercrash (Core Class, 2024)
- Known designers: Mark Maher (Hasbro), Takio Ejima (TakaraTomy)
- The Legacy: United Armorizers are the successors to the Junkions released in Legacy: Evolution.
- While Magneous, Shard and Nucleous inherit the Weaponizers', Fossilizers', and Junkions' abilities to be split apart to form armor and weapons, Bouldercrash is more akin to the smaller partner figures of Legends Class toys from Thrilling 30, triple changing from robot to vehicle to weapon for bigger figures to wield.
Notes
- The Armorizers take inspiration from both Daira's rocky inhabitants as seen in the Headmasters episode "My Friend Sixshot!", and the Rock Lords of GoBots fame.[1]
- While next to no information is provided on Armorizer physiology, species creator Mark Maher notes that they are definitely not sparked in the vein of traditional Transformers, and the design team tended towards concave torsos to illustrate this.[2]
Foreign names
- Japanese: Infernac (インフェルナック Inferunakku), Armorizer System (アーマーライザーシステム Āmāraizā Shisutemu)
